Back in 2000, I was a huge fan of a local band called Malkovich. They played a decent Swing Kids-copy style, and I was blown away by the intensity. xJochemx and I met through the internet and went to a show together in Rotterdam, where Malkovich and Amanda Woodward were playing. xJochemx told me he'd bring some proper screamo so I could get acquainted with the music. He gave me Saetia's discography, Funeral Diner's split with Staircase and Racebannon's In the Grips of the Light. Save that last one, I loved the bands, the music and the passion. After that, hoarding Level-Plane, Nova, Eartwatersky and Robotic Empire records brought me most of the joy in my sad life.
